Human Synergistic:
Life style inventory (LSI) has been created in the 70’s by clayton latferty. It combines several major theories about human nature which measure the level of effectiveness on 12 specific style of thinking, behaving & interacting. His model identifies the strength & highlighted the area of improvements. It provides a feedback on behavioral pattern that people can improve & work on it.
The results are plotted on the circumplex which is compared against 14,000 individual. Below diagram shows (SLI) & how the circle looks

The organization I work for, Starbucks is highly diversified. In my opinion, Starbucks successfully employs each of the seven diversity components: “authentic leadership commitment, clear organizational communication, inclusive recruitment practices, long-term retention strategies, incorporating diversity into main work of the organization, diversity management metrics, and expansive external relationships” (CanÌas, Sondak 2014). With that being said, Starbucks could improve by incorporating diversity into main work of the organization. One way Starbucks proves their commitment to diversity is authentic by holding a diverse board of directors. Of the seven board members, three are women and one of these women is of an African descent.
